Output dd4df4239b345f95f2533e176ae2ede1cee994b0054a7f5a39e8a62f072834a9:2

value
18330527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418fdba665b62b829759031242b225d0d6d0944b OP_EQUAL
address
37fgBScJ2UvfnLfio3DhSCWAtRDF9rQ1h6
transaction
dd4df4239b345f95f2533e176ae2ede1cee994b0054a7f5a39e8a62f072834a9
spent
true